Eli Lilly and Company $LLY is Robeco Institutional Asset Management B.V.’s 10th Largest Position

Robeco Institutional Asset Management B.V. reduced its position in shares of Eli Lilly and Company (NYSE:LLYFree Report) by 11.0%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 726,465 shares of the company’s stock after selling 89,342 shares during the period. Eli Lilly and Company comprises about 1.1% of Robeco Institutional Asset Management B.V.’s holdings, making the stock its 10th largest holding. Robeco Institutional Asset Management B.V.’s holdings in Eli Lilly and Company were worth $780,717,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Eli Lilly and Company Stock Down 0.7%

Eli Lilly and Company stock opened at $922.83 on Wednesday. Eli Lilly and Company has a 1-year low of $623.78 and a 1-year high of $1,133.95.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.54, a current ratio of 1.58 and a quick ratio of 1.19. The stock has a market cap of $871.91 billion, a PE ratio of 40.21, a P/E/G ratio of 1.08 and a beta of 0.51. The stock’s fifty day moving average is $980.12 and its two-hundred day moving average is $980.41.

Eli Lilly and Company (NYSE:LLYG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, February 4th. The company reported $7.54 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$7.48 by $0.06. Eli Lilly and Company had a return on equity of 102.94% and a net margin of 31.66%.The company had revenue of $19.29 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$17.85 billion. During the same period last year, the firm earned $5.32 earnings per share. Eli Lilly and Company’s quarterly revenue was up 42.6% on a year-over-year basis. Eli Lilly and Company has set its FY 2026 guidance at 33.500-35.000 EPS. On average, sell-side analysts expect that Eli Lilly and Company will post 23.48 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Eli Lilly and Company News Roundup

Here are the key news stories impacting Eli Lilly and Company this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: Jaypirca (pirtobrutinib) posted positive Phase 3 BRUIN CLL?322 results showing significantly extended progression?free survival when added to venetoclax + rituximab — a fourth positive Phase 3 readout that meaningfully strengthens Lilly’s oncology franchise and potential label expansion. PR Newswire: Jaypirca Phase 3
  • Positive Sentiment: Lilly acquired preclinical ADC specialist CrossBridge in a roughly $300M deal, adding antibody?drug conjugate expertise to its oncology pipeline — an inorganic move that accelerates biologics/ADC capabilities. FierceBiotech: CrossBridge acquisition
  • Positive Sentiment: Lilly expanded external AI ties by enabling Vasa Therapeutics to use Lilly’s TuneLab AI/ML drug?discovery models — this monetizes Lilly’s platform and can accelerate external partnerships and milestone revenue. Yahoo Finance: Vasa / TuneLab
  • Positive Sentiment: Regulatory approval of Foundayo (Lilly’s oral GLP?1 weight?loss pill) continues to underpin the company’s blockbuster growth narrative and long?term revenue trajectory in obesity care. The Motley Fool: Foundayo approval

Eli Lilly and Company Company Profile

(Free Report)

Eli Lilly and Company (NYSE: LLY) is a global pharmaceutical company founded in 1876 and headquartered in Indianapolis, Indiana. The company researches, develops, manufactures and commercializes a broad range of medicines and therapies for patients worldwide. Eli Lilly maintains operations and commercial presence across North America, Europe, Asia and other regions, serving both developed and emerging markets.
